The typical annual salary range for most roles at New York State Gaming Commission is approximately from $79,640 to $104,270. It's important to remember that these are overall averages, actual salaries vary significantly based on specific job titles, years of experience, skills, and location.
The average annual salary at New York State Gaming Commission is $91,103, or an hourly wage of $44, in comparison to Valley Central School District which pays $98,866 per year or $48 per hour.
Yes, salaries often differ between departments at New York State Gaming Commission due to varying market demand for specific skill sets and the nature of the roles. For example, technical roles in Engineering or IT may command different salary ranges compared to roles in Marketing or Human Resources.
Experience level is a significant factor in determining salary at New York State Gaming Commission, as it is with most employers. Generally, employees with more years of relevant experience and a proven track record can command higher salaries. For example, a senior-level role will typically have a higher pay band than an entry-level or mid-career position within the same job family.
